The Tapestry of Indian Family Drama and Lifestyle Stories Indian family drama is more than just a storytelling genre; it is a cultural mirror that reflects the intricate dance between deep-rooted traditions and the relentless push of modernity. These narratives, whether found in ancient epics like the Mahabharata or contemporary web series, explore the "warmth, chaos, love, and conflicts" that define the South Asian household. Indian family dramas and lifestyle stories frequently explore the tensions between tradition and modernity, as characters navigate the challenges of urbanization, education, and career aspirations.
